The First 72 Hours After a Stroke, Crucial for Recovery and Saving Lives

Did you know that you could lose approximately 1.9 million neurons after a stroke hit? The deadly truth is that stroke remains the second leading cause of death across the globe! Malaysia is no exception, and it’s not good. This silent killer caused nearly 200,000 deaths in 2019.

Bear in mind, the first 72 hours after a stroke could be your “extra life ticket” if you’re fast enough to seek treatment. Go turbo ’cause every minute is precious. It’s time to be the Flash and head to your Doctor!

Dr Aaron

When a stroke strikes, the brain is deprived of oxygen, and damage starts immediately. Quick interventions, like clot-busting drugs or thrombectomy, can save lives and preserve brain function, but these must happen fast.” –Dr Aaron. 

You heard your Doctor there. Time is brain! Patients who get thrombolytic therapy within 4.5 hours of a stroke are way more likely to bounce back strong. That “golden hour” really is the game-changer for full recovery.
